Cauliflower Sauce

Ingredients
- 1 Cauliflower
- 1 1/2 T Butter
- 1 1/2 t Olive Oil
- 1 Garlic
- 6 c water
- Salt
- Pepper
- Any other spices

Preparation
Step 1
Boil Cauliflower florets in 6 c water.
Step 2
As it is boiling, peel garlic and cook in butter and olive oil.
Step 3
Blend in garlic mixture in 1 cup of cauliflower water.
Step 4
Add boiled cauliflower in blender with spices and blend.

VIDEO: Cheesy Cauliflower Pizza Cups
These Cheesy Cauliflower Pizza Cups are just what you need when snack o'clock rolls around!
Ingredients
Makes 6
- 1/2 cauliflower head
- 8 eggs for cauliflower mix
- Pepper
- Salt
- 4-6 cups shredded cheese
- 6 slices salami
- 6 tbsp pizza Sauce
Method
- Boil diced cauliflower in salted water until tender.
- Blend, then transfer to mixing bowl.
- Mix in 2 eggs, pepper and 2 cups of shredded cheese
- Share the cauliflower mixture out between 6 ramekins, forming little cups
- Add 1 cup of shredded cheese
- Bake for 25 min at 375°F
- Add a slice of salami, a tbsp of pizza sauce, and one raw egg to each ramekin
- Top with cheese and return to oven for 7 min at 375°F
- Serve, and enjoy!
